If an appliance is more than halfway through its life cycle and the repair costs more than half the price of a new one, you should consider replacing it. However, if restoring it costs less than half the price of buying something new and it is not nearing the end of its useful life, repairing it is definitely the preferable alternative.

Repairs are restorative tasks performed when an asset breaks, is damaged, or ceases performing. Maintenance is defined as normal actions and/or corrective or preventive repairs performed on assets to avoid damage and extend their life expectancy.
